Admissions to the diploma program are based on the POLYCET (CEEP) entrance test, with no interview process required. Successful candidates attend a counseling session for certificate verification and college selection. The college features a faculty-student ratio of 15:1, ensuring personalized support and guidance, especially in lab work and project-based learning. Tuition is set at INR 30,000 per year, with a total cost of around INR 1 lakh, excluding additional services. While no direct scholarships are available, state government tuition fee reimbursement is an option, helping to alleviate costs for families. The college enjoys a 60% placement rate, although about half the students are ineligible due to backlogs. Major recruiters include Amazon, Cap Gemini, Tech Mahindra, and more, offering average salaries of INR 12,000 per month, with top packages from Amazon reaching INR 31 lakhs per annum. Internships often offer stipends, averaging INR 15,000. The Jagan Anna Vidya Devena scholarship and full fee reimbursement from the Andhra Pradesh government provide significant support for economically disadvantaged students. Notably, stipends from companies like Surya Tech, Ronch Polymer, Royal Enfield, and Kyb contribute to student financial aid.
